GitLab Community Edition
GitLab Community Edition is a powerful, self-hosted DevOps platform that includes comprehensive version control capabilities. While GitLab offers a paid enterprise version, the Community Edition provides a robust set of features, including Git repository management, CI/CD pipelines, issue tracking, a built-in wiki, and a container registry.
